P H U K E T
The biggest of 1400-plus islands
in the country is also the most
popular destination in Thailand
outside of Bangkok. Stroll through
Phuket Old Town, and its brightly
painted shophouses the origin of
which can be traced back to tin
mining that made the fortune of
the island.
C H I A N M A I
The restored walls and moat of
the fortified city are the most
visible reminder of the Rose of
the North’s past as the capital
of the Lanna Kingdom. The city
center is dotted with impressive
temples like the 80-meter-high
Wat Chedi Luang.
KO H C H A N G
Koh Chang, along with
neighboring Koh Kood and Koh
Mak are the easternmost of
Thailand’s islands and some of the
best Thai beach destinations.
Even Koh Chang’s built-up west
coast is low-key compared to the
busiest beaches of Phuket and
Samui and offers the comfort of
properties like the Centara
Tropicana or Chivapuri.
K A N C H A N A B U R I
Kanchanaburi is the location of
the famed Bridge over the River
Kwai and history buffs flock to
see the infamous bridge, the
museum, and wartime
cemeteries. The province is also
home to stunning natural sites
like Erawan National Park and the
popular seven-tiered Erawan
Waterfall.
KO H YA O N O I
Koh Yao Noi (Small Long Island
in Thai) and the even lesser
developed Koh Yao Yai (Big
Long Island) are perhaps some
of the most untouched corners
of natural beauty in Thailand,
making them one of the best
beaches destinations in
Thailand.
